Transaction ae8793c1bb351db39dde2ece0142a5014e344279c72cba9875e678f50fe26449
1 Input
2 Outputs
- ae8793c1bb351db39dde2ece0142a5014e344279c72cba9875e678f50fe26449:0
- ae8793c1bb351db39dde2ece0142a5014e344279c72cba9875e678f50fe26449:1
value 3136310
address 14E32EASBjnJPwxXqFzeForxmHtgPoYem4
value 16500000
address 1LDZCX7kyE2Nzy9urL2pFpEP1jXS2hv43r